IN THE ZONE HUA HIN AND CHA AM PLAN RESURFACES

HUA HIN THAILAND The plan mooted some time ago to merge the two coastal districts of Hua Hin and Cha-am into a special administrative zone is back on the government agenda as part of a pilot project for sustainable development to mark His Majesty’s 84th birthday this December. Interior Minister Chaovarat Chanweerakul was due to seek Cabinet approval this week to merge the two districts and put them under a special administration scheme. Hua Hin currently comes under the jurisdiction of Prachuap Khiri Khan province, while Cha-am is in Phetchaburi province. Upgrading the two districts would enhance the development of tourism and streamline the management of royally initiated projects in the area, the Interior Ministry believes. The special administrative zone would be placed under the direct supervision of the prime minister, with Deputy Lord Chamberlain Distorn Vajarodaya acting as adviser. The new Hua Hin-Cha-am special administrative zone would come into existence once the legislation on special local administrative organisations is enacted. Under this legislation, all office holders will be elected locally instead of being appointed by the central government. The establishment of the administrative zone will be done in two parts - the master plan will be drafted this year and the plan implemented between 2012 and 2017. It is thus not clear as yet what impact this change will have on residents and business, but it can only be hoped that it will help improve some aspects of the area, such as key infrastructure and in particular the water supply.

CONNETICUT, USA Man calls police to ask for advice on growing cannabis While most cannabis growers realise what they’re doing is wrong, one US man clearly didn’t know it was illegal to farm the plant, but he soon found out when he called the police. Twenty-one-year-old Robert Michelson from Conneticut innocently called 911 to find out how much trouble he’d get into for growing marijuana and was promptly arrested by officers. Michelson was reportedly told by the police dispatcher that growing pot was illegal and was warned he could be arrested. So he did what any polite citizen would do - he quickly said thank you for the advice and hung up the phone. Unfortunately for him, officers

already had his details and he’d rather stupidly told the controller there was ‘possibly’ a crime going on at his home, so they went to the property where they seized a small quantity of cannabis and drug paraphernalia. The hapless grower was released on $5,000 (150,000 baht) bail after being charged with marijuana possession and other crimes. He admitted he bought the seeds and equipment with the intention of growing the drug. CALIFORNIA, USA Man killed by knife-wielding cock A man in California was killed after being stabbed in the leg by a bird taking part in an illegal cockfight. Jose Luis Ochoa was knifed in the calf by a blade attached to the limb of the bird and was declared dead in

hospital on January 30th, two hours after the incident. The Kern County coroner said a post-mortem examination concluded Mr Ochoa had died of a ‘sharp force injury’ to his right leg. It is possible that a delay between him sustaining the injury and receiving medical treatment could have contributed to his death. Cockfighting is illegal in the US and, although no arrests have yet been made, officials are said to be looking into the incident. Police arriving at the scene reportedly found five dead roosters, among other evidence of the blood sport taking place. Last month, a man in India died after the rooster he entered into a cockfight attacked him, slashing his throat with razor blades attached to its legs.

Do you wonder why we say certain things, or what they really mean? Each week we will examine a different word or phrase and tell you how it came about. This week it is.. Brand spanking new Entirely new. To those of us of a certain age the word brand turns our thoughts to Hollywood B-features and images of cowboys branding cattle on the open range. That’s not the origin of this phrase, but it’s not a million miles away in terms of meaning. A hot burned wooden stake has been called a brand since at least 950 AD. To brand means to ‘make an indelible mark of ownership’, especially with a hot stake or iron. This verb usage has been known since the Middle Ages and is clearly derived from the earlier name (we might say brand name - but we’ll come to that later). The earliest citation of ‘brand new’ is in John Foxe’s Sermons, 1570: “New bodies, new minds and all thinges new, brande-newe.” Terms that are old often come to us with a variety of spellings. In this case there are many variants, notable ‘bran new’, for example: John Gay’s, The What d’ye call it? - a farce, 1714: “Wear these Breeches Tom; they’re quite bran-new.” The Times from 1788: “The liquor fpoiled a bran new pair of fattin breaches.” [Note that The Times persisted in printing the long form of ‘s’ characters (which resemble the letter ‘f’ with a short cross-bar) as late as 1788. This form had been commonplace in printed material until about 1780, when it went into a sudden decline. Other spelling include ‘brent’ and ‘brank’. Burns, Tam o’ Shanter, 1790: “Nae cotillon brent new frae France.” Scott, St. Ronan’s, 1824: “Yeomen with the brank new blues and buckskins.” These spellings, of course, aren’t different words but

just alternative pronunciations of ‘brand’. It is sometimes put about that ‘brand new’ comes from marketing jargon, where terms like ‘brand loyalty’ etc. are commonplace. That’s about a thousand years too late as the origin, but again, it does have the same meaning as the early form. A brand in marketing terms comes from the meaning of the word as ‘a particular class of goods, as indicated by a trade mark’. So, that’s ‘brand new’; what about the double form ‘brand spanking new’? Spanking is little more than an intensifier in this phrase. The word does have a distinct meaning; unrelated to ‘slapping with the hand’, i.e. ‘exceptionally large or fine’. For example, Fanshawe’s Love for Love’s sake, 1666: “What a spanking Labradora!” Like the variety of spellings there are variants of the intensified form - ‘brand span new’, ‘spick and span new’, etc. These citations pre-date any known version of ‘brand spanking new’: Henry Angelo’s Reminiscences, 1830: “His feet were thrust into a bran-span new pair of fashionable pumps.” The Whitby Glossary, 1855: “Brandnew, Brandspandernew, fresh from the maker’s hands, or ‘spic and span new’.” It appears that whoever coined ‘brand spanking new’ did so by appropriating the imagery of ‘spick and span’, the rhyme of ‘bran’ and ‘span’ and the meaning of ‘spanking’. That is, it is a pleasant-sounding phrase with some appropriate associations. Whatever the intent of the early users of the phrase, it is in Eric Partridge’s meaning of the term, a catchphrase, i.e. it has caught on. It appears to have been coined around the turn of the 20th century and is still in common use. The earliest printed citation we can find is in a story about a luckless sea captain, in Harper’s New Monthly Magazine, April, 1860, entitled Captain Tom: A Resurrection: He had a new vessel, he had a new crew, he had brand spanking new fish-gear; but he had his old luck.

CHA-AM MALL GETS GREEN LIGHT A new ‘green community’ mall project is due to begin in Cha-am in Phetchaburi province in April. Anek Hoontrakul, president of St James Hotel Co, said the company would spend 450-500 million baht to develop the project on an 86-rai plot next to Dusit Resort and Polo Club. About 200 million baht will be used to develop the 28-rai first phase - the Botaneo lifestyle mall and a 300room four-star hotel. Construction of the mall will start in the next two or three months and will deliver space to tenants for decoration in November. The mall

will cover 44,800 square metres, with about 20% devoted to restaurants, shops, a supermarket, banks and spas. The remaining space will be used for a garden, a lake, a maze, a children’s playground and a walkway leading down to the beach. The mall will be separated into six zones with 100 tenants and parking for 500 cars. Mr Anek said the development had been postponed for three years because he was not confident in the density of population and tourists “It is the right time to dust off the project because the tourism business in Cha-am, Hua Hin and Pran Buri is continuing to grow. The number of tourist arrivals to Hua Hin was about

two million last year, contributing about 9 billion baht,” he said. Botaneo will be a new destination for middle- to high-end customers to dine, chill out, shop or even have spa treatments in the same compound. Space reservations began last month. The company expects about 60% of space to be booked by May and 100% by early next year. It will then spend another 250-300 million baht to develop a 100-villa resort on a 75-rai plot behind its shopping mall in 2015. The project will be opened in 2016. Room rates for villas will be 10,000 baht per night. (Bangkok Post)

Telephone tor-ra-sap The following is an imaginary conversation on the telephone. If you listen to a Thai person speaking on the phone you will often hear them say “krub, krub, krub”. This is like saying “yes, yes, yes”. To be extra polite to an older person like grandparents you would say “krub phom” every few minutes. Don’t forget girls will say “kaa”. Sam: Hello. May I speak to Danny please? hello khor sai Danny krub Danny’s dad: Who is calling? jark krai * krub Sam: Sam. Sam krub Danny’s dad: Please wait. ror suk kru krub Sam: OK. krub Danny: Hello. hello Sam: Hello. Danny? This is Sam. hello Danny rer** nee Sam na Danny: Hi Sam. What’s up? sawatdee*** Sam mee a-rai rer Extra phrases: Danny is not here. Danny mai yoo When will Danny be back? laew Danny ja glub mua rai krub That’s all, bye? kae nee na krub sa wat dee krub Can you tell him/her that I called? bork khao wa phom toh ma dai mai? Can you ask them to call me back? bork khao hai toh glub har phom dai mai? My number is ... ber toh ra sub phom keu ... Contact dtid dtor

Extension 123 dtor neung song sam Wrong number toh phid TIPS: * literally “from who” ** “rer” means question mark. *** with friends “sawatdee” can be shortened to “watdee”. “Sawatdee” is normally used with elders.
